How much does it cost to rent a home in Pocatello?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Pocatello 2 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$1,011 | $700 | $1,325 |
Pocatello 3 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$1,681 | $950 | $2,499 |
Pocatello 4 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,193 | $1,600 | $2,850 |
Pocatello 5 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,124 | $1,899 | $2,550 |
Pocatello 6 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,099 | $2,099 | $2,099 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Pocatello
What type of rentals are currently available in Pocatello?
There are currently 126 Apartments for Rent in Pocatello, ID with pricing that ranges from $300 to $2,050. There are also 40 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in Pocatello ranging from $695 to $2,850.
What is the current price range for Rental Homes in Pocatello?
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in Pocatello ranges from $695 to $2,850 with an average monthly rent of $1,711.
How much are larger Three and Four Bedroom Rentals in Pocatello?
For those who are looking for larger living arrangements, Three Bedroom Apartments in Pocatello range from $999 to $2,050, while Three Bedroom Homes, Condos, and Townhomes for rent range from $950 to $2,499. Four Bedroom Single-Family rentals are also available starting from $1,600 and Four Bedroom Apartments start at $1,450.
